CHANGELOG — Pinwright 1.6.0

For the release manager: the setting PIN_STRICT has been renamed to DEPENDENCY_PIN_POLICY to clarify that it governs our pinning policy, not strictness of hash checks. All manifests under the Quillbase monorepo were updated; downstream consumers must edit their env files by Friday's cut. The policy resolver also now authenticates against the internal registry, so directly beneath the renamed setting you must add:

secret setting of bawif-bawig: RELAY_SECRET8=bb69ec72

Handover: the orphaned-resource sweeper (codename Gleanix) runs nightly and deletes volumes, snapshots, and DNS entries with no live owner tag. It's conservative — anything ambiguous goes to the quarantine list, which you should review weekly. Logs live in the Fennwald bucket; the dry-run flag is your friend for the first month. The sweeper's service account rotates credentials automatically, but if rotation fails you'll need to re-seed it manually from the offline store, which opens with the recovery passphrase below.

unlock words, yawig-kagef: gordor-holvan-ulaael-pramir-ulaiel-tamdor

Next year's plan holds total headcount flat at current levels, with reallocation rather than growth. Engineering gains six roles, offset by reductions in field operations and the Melbrook support desk. Contractor spend is capped at this year's actuals. Backfill approvals will require sign-off from the finance partner for each department. Heads of department should submit revised org charts by end of month. The confidential note below sets out the business rationale for these constraints.

internal memo for yahag-tahog: The pricing group signed off on a budget of $152.8 million for Project Soriel.

### Meeting Notes — Wiki Access Review (Brindlewood project)

We agreed to restrict edit rights on the Brindlewood wiki to the platform-docs role, with read access remaining open to all staff. Role assignments will be audited quarterly, and removals logged. Future maintainers should note that ownership of the access-control policy now sits with the person named below.

named custodian: Oliath Ralax